This commit is contained in:
Ladebeze66 2025-03-27 14:52:56 +01:00
parent 5128ea8904
commit 157355b2cb
3 changed files with 11084 additions and 0 deletions

View File

@ -0,0 +1,65 @@
# SpecStory Artifacts Directory
This directory is automatically created and maintained by the SpecStory extension to preserve your Cursor composer and chat history.
## What's Here?
- `.specstory/history`: Contains markdown files of your AI coding sessions
- Each file represents a separate chat or composer session
- Files are automatically updated as you work
- `.specstory/cursor_rules_backups`: Contains backups of the `.cursor/rules/derived-cursor-rules.mdc` file
- Backups are automatically created each time the `.cursor/rules/derived-cursor-rules.mdc` file is updated
- You can enable/disable the Cursor Rules feature in the SpecStory settings, it is disabled by default
## Valuable Uses
- Capture: Keep your context window up-to-date when starting new Chat/Composer sessions via @ references
- Search: For previous prompts and code snippets
- Learn: Meta-analyze your patterns and learn from your past experiences
- Derive: Keep Cursor on course with your past decisions by automatically deriving Cursor rules from your AI interactions
## Version Control
We recommend keeping this directory under version control to maintain a history of your AI interactions. However, if you prefer not to version these files, you can exclude them by adding this to your `.gitignore`:
```
.specstory
```
We recommend not keeping the `.specstory/cursor_rules_backups` directory under version control if you are already using git to version the `.cursor/rules` directory, and committing regularly. You can exclude it by adding this to your `.gitignore`:
```
.specstory/cursor_rules_backups
```
## Searching Your Codebase
When searching your codebase in Cursor, search results may include your previous AI coding interactions. To focus solely on your actual code files, you can exclude the AI interaction history from search results.
To exclude AI interaction history:
1. Open the "Find in Files" search in Cursor (Cmd/Ctrl + Shift + F)
2. Navigate to the "files to exclude" section
3. Add the following pattern:
```
.specstory/*
```
This will ensure your searches only return results from your working codebase files.
## Notes
- Auto-save only works when Cursor/sqlite flushes data to disk. This results in a small delay after the AI response is complete before SpecStory can save the history.
- Auto-save does not yet work on remote WSL workspaces.
## Settings
You can control auto-saving behavior in Cursor:
1. Open Cursor → Settings → VS Code Settings (Cmd/Ctrl + ,)
2. Search for "SpecStory"
3. Find "Auto Save" setting to enable/disable
Auto-save occurs when changes are detected in Cursor's sqlite database, or every 2 minutes as a safety net.

File diff suppressed because it is too large Load Diff

View File

@ -35,3 +35,35 @@ Formatage de la réponse:
- je voudrai que ta réponse soit dans un fichier .md que tu pourras ajuster et corrigé en fonction de mes ajustements et qu'il soit téléchargeable
- je te joint le fichier .md du code récupérer sur le projet
Tu es spécilaiste en LLM et RAG.
Je voudrai que:
1. dans un premier fichier .md tu m'expliques en détails avec de la documentation le fonctionnement d'un RAG dans le cadre d'une utilisation de LLM locaux
2. dans un autre fichier tu récoltes un maximun d'informations sur RAGFLOW en particulier
3. dans un autre fichier dans le cadre de mon travail mon superviseur a besoin de mon aide pour mieux utiliser et formater les fichiers dans ragflow j'y ai en partie accès par une adresse locale dans le navigatuer:
- je voudrai savoir ce que je peux faire dans ce cadre qu'elles sont les possibilités de configuration et autre dont je dispose
- comment m'organiser
- j'ai un système d'agents avec mes différents modèles LLM au travail:
-dois je créer une classe dédié au rag si oui comment procéder dans le cadre de ragflow
4. dans un dernier fichier dans le cadre d'une utilisation personnelle je voudrai installer ragflow sur mon serveur local:
- il est sous windows puis je l'installé sous windows sinon qu'elles sont mes possibilités et mes limitations si je dois passer par un sous système linux
- je vais créer une base de donnée pour mes notes obsidian
- une autre base de donnée avc mes projets mon code
- de la documentation concernant mes projets ou tout autre intérêts qui m'est propre
- comment mettre en place tout cela
Je voudrai que tu analyses ces deux projets AIangent2 étant l'ancien et llm_lab-test le nouveau:
1. je voudrai que tu enregistres ton analyse dans llm-lab-test en .md
-différences structurelle entre les deux projets
-tout ce qui te semble important
2. Je sais que dans l'ancien projet le choix a été fait de créer une classe "abstraite"? pour les agents également:
- es ce que je me trompe? en tout cas il y a une classe générale je voudrai que tu m'explique cela et tu le rajoute dans le .md
- Quel est l'intérêt de créer une telle classe
-si intérêt significatif peut on le reproduire dans le nouveau projet sans modifier son fonctionnement
-si possible le faire
- Ensuite dans l'ancien projet il existe comme dans le nouveau des classes spécifiques à différents llm
-tu peux documenter et expliquer chacun d'eux dans le .md j'ai vu qu'il s'agit souvent de llm en ligne?
-Il existe également un classe mistral mais ce n'est pas le même que dans le nouveau projet
- tu peux la recréé dans un nouvelle classe
- j'ai également vu pour llama-vision l'ancien projet possède beaucoup plus de paramètres que le nouveau
- je voudrai adapter le nouveau en fonction de ces paramètres
Si tu le peux résumes moi ma demande afin de vérifier que nous soyons daccord sur la marche à suivre si c'est ok je te le dirai et tu pourras commencer le travail.